When the temperature of the air is 50°C, the velocity of a sound wave traveling through the air is approximately

In this item, we are to calculate for the speed or velocity of sound in air with a temperature of 50°C. The dependence of the velocity of sound in temperature is expressed in the following equation:
v = 331 m/s + (0.6 m/s°C)(T)
where v is the velocity and T is temperature.

Substituting the known values from the given,
v = 331 + (0.6)(50) = 361 m/s

Thus, the velocity of sound in air at 50°C is approximately 361 m/s.
